Smart contracts have become a fundamental component of blockchain-based projects, powering everything from DeFi protocols to NFT marketplaces. Their ability to execute transactions automatically without intermediaries has opened new opportunities for innovation and efficiency. However, with this power comes risk. A single coding vulnerability can lead to multi-million-dollar losses, making smart contract audits a non-negotiable step for serious blockchain ventures.
For many founders and project teams, one of the first questions is: How much does a smart contract audit cost? The answer is not as straightforward as a fixed number. Audit prices can range anywhere from a few thousand dollars to tens of thousands, depending on the scope, complexity, and quality of the service provider. This guide breaks down the cost factors, budget options, and premium audit scenarios so you can make an informed decision without overpaying—or underinvesting—in your project’s security.
Before diving into pricing, it’s important to understand why an audit is essential. Smart contracts, once deployed on a blockchain, are immutable. This means that if there is a bug, it cannot be easily fixed without significant disruption. The high-profile exploits in DeFi platforms, DAO projects, and NFT marketplaces have shown that attackers are quick to exploit vulnerabilities for financial gain.
An audit not only identifies and mitigates these risks but also signals credibility to investors, partners, and users. Skipping or underfunding an audit can damage your brand, hinder adoption, and expose your project to devastating losses. In many ways, the cost of an audit is an investment in trust and long-term stability.
The price of a smart contract audit can vary significantly. Factors like project complexity, audit methodology, the reputation of the auditor, and delivery timeframes all play a role. While it’s tempting to view audits as an expense to minimize, cost often reflects the depth of analysis and the expertise applied.
At the lower end of the spectrum, basic audits from lesser-known providers can cost around $2,000 to $5,000. Mid-tier providers with a stronger track record may charge $5,000 to $15,000. At the high end, top-tier audit firms working with major blockchain projects can command $20,000 to $50,000 or more for comprehensive reviews.
For small-scale projects or early-stage startups, budget audits can seem attractive. These audits are often provided by freelance auditors or smaller firms that specialize in more straightforward smart contracts. They can offer quick turnaround times and lower pricing, making them accessible to teams with limited funds.
However, the limitations are worth noting. Budget audits may rely on automated tools without in-depth manual code reviews, potentially missing subtle logic errors or vulnerabilities. They may also provide shorter, less detailed reports that offer minimal guidance on remediation. While these audits can serve as a preliminary check, they should not be the sole layer of security for projects expecting significant transaction volumes or handling large amounts of user funds.
Mid-tier audit providers often strike the best balance for many blockchain projects. These firms combine automated analysis tools with manual code reviews conducted by experienced auditors. They typically offer detailed reports outlining vulnerabilities, potential exploits, and recommended fixes, along with follow-up reviews to verify that issues have been addressed.
This category generally covers audits priced between $5,000 and $15,000. The scope is usually more comprehensive than budget audits, with deeper analysis and testing. Mid-tier audits are suitable for projects with moderate complexity, such as DeFi lending protocols, token contracts with advanced features, or NFT platforms integrating multiple smart contracts.
For large-scale blockchain applications, high-value DeFi protocols, or enterprise-level projects, premium audits are the most reliable route. Premium audit firms like CertiK, Trail of Bits, and OpenZeppelin bring top-tier expertise, extensive track records, and proven methodologies. These audits involve rigorous manual reviews by multiple auditors, comprehensive testing environments, and sometimes even formal verification techniques to mathematically prove the correctness of critical code sections.
Premium audits can cost $20,000 to $50,000 or more, but the value lies in the depth of analysis, the credibility boost, and the confidence it gives stakeholders. Many institutional investors and venture capitalists view a premium audit from a leading firm as a prerequisite for funding. For projects handling hundreds of millions in assets, this level of security is not optional—it’s a necessity.
Several elements determine the final price of an audit. One of the most significant is code complexity. A simple ERC-20 token contract is far easier and cheaper to audit than a complex DeFi protocol with multiple integrated contracts and external dependencies.
Audit methodology also matters. Some providers rely heavily on automated scanning tools, while others perform extensive manual reviews and dynamic testing. Reputation and experience of the audit team can drive prices up, as can turnaround times—expedited audits typically come at a premium. Additionally, the inclusion of post-audit support or multiple review rounds can increase the overall cost but deliver a stronger security outcome.
When weighing audit costs, it’s important to frame the decision in terms of risk management. The financial and reputational damage of a smart contract exploit often far outweighs the cost of a thorough audit. While spending $20,000 on an audit may seem expensive, it is minimal compared to the millions that could be lost in a breach.
Moreover, the market perception of your project benefits significantly from a reputable audit. A high-quality audit report published on your website or GitHub can attract more users, encourage partnerships, and strengthen investor confidence.
Regardless of whether you choose a budget, mid-tier, or premium audit, preparation is key to maximizing value. Ensuring your code is well-documented and thoroughly tested before sending it to auditors can reduce the time and cost of the process. Communicating clearly about your project’s requirements, risk areas, and timelines helps auditors focus on the most critical aspects of your code.
For teams with limited budgets, combining a preliminary budget audit with an eventual premium audit closer to launch can be a cost-effective approach. This strategy allows for early detection of issues while ensuring final code security is validated by top-tier experts.
The decision ultimately depends on your project’s scale, funding, and security requirements. For small community-driven projects with low transaction volumes, a budget or mid-tier audit may be sufficient. For high-stakes DeFi protocols or platforms expecting large user bases, premium audits offer the assurance and market credibility needed to compete at the highest level.
The right choice is the one that aligns with your project’s security needs and long-term goals while staying within budget constraints. Remember that an audit is not a one-time checkbox—it’s part of an ongoing commitment to maintaining secure, reliable smart contracts.
Smart contract audit costs vary widely, but so does the value they provide. From budget-friendly options for early-stage projects to premium audits that deliver unmatched security and credibility, there is a solution for every stage of blockchain development. The key is understanding the trade-offs, preparing effectively, and viewing the cost as an investment in both technical safety and market trust.